0

我正在开发一个 Android 应用程序,其中设备连接到带有 Java 服务器的套接字。如果服务器未启动设备以指示服务器未连接,我该怎么做?

4

1 回答 1

0

如果套接字无法连接,将引发异常。那么如何捕获该异常try...catch并显示消息或通知,例如:

服务器目前处于离线状态,请稍后再试。

IOException如果套接字无法连接,则此异常应该是。

  1. UnknownHostException- 如果无法确定主机的 IP 地址。
  2. IOException- 如果在创建套接字时发生 I/O 错误。

请参阅http://docs.oracle.com/javase/7/docs/api/java/net/Socket.html

于 2013-11-09T21:57:20.393 回答